1. 程式人生 > >Linux nohup命令詳解pk10源碼下載

Linux nohup命令詳解pk10源碼下載

後臺 源碼下載 err 輸入 stdout 文件夾 表示 其它 語法

現象:pk10源碼下載(企 娥:217 1793 408)

把java程序打成jar包後,放到linux上通過putty或其它終端執行的時候,

如果按照:java -jar xxxx.jar執行,當我們退出putty或終端的時候,xxxx.jar這個程序也會停止。

為了保證程序能夠一直運行,應該改為這樣運行:nohup java -jar xxx.jar&命令,則程序會在後臺一直運行,

值得註意的是,此時程序控制臺輸出會被轉移到nohup.out文件中,

這個nohup.out文件的位置就在jar包的當前文件夾內。

現對上面的命令進行下解釋

用途:不掛斷地運行命令。
語法:nohup Command [ Arg ... ] [ & ]

描述:nohup 命令運行由 Command 參數和任何相關的 Arg 參數指定的命令,忽略所有掛斷(SIGHUP)信號。在註銷後使用 nohup 命令運行後臺中的程序。要運行後臺中的 nohup 命令,添加 & ( 表示“and”的符號)到命令的尾部。

操作系統中有三個常用的流:
  0:標準輸入流 stdin
  1:標準輸出流 stdout
  2:標準錯誤流 stderr
  一般當我們用 > console.txt,實際是 1>console.txt的省略用法;< console.txt ,實際是 0 < console.txt的省略用法。

Linux nohup命令詳解pk10源碼下載